I Am Hungry By Michael Rosen Illustrated by Robert Starling The second in a funny new series from former Children's Laureate Michael Rosen and rising star Robert Starling. Look out, this squirrel is HUNGRY. So hungry it could eat boiled rice, chocolate mice, a gingerbread man ... even a frying pan!
Bradford Literature Festival Digital Programme 2020 www.bradfordlitfest.co.uk Recommended for ages 5-10+ Join award winning children's poet Joseph Coelho, as he invites you to read along from his book, Poems Aloud. Joseph will read poems about animals, poems about feelings, poems about music, poems to join in with and poems to perform in special ways.

A delightful collection of short poems about creatures that live under or near the ocean. The large brightly coloured illustrations by David Wojtowycz give added character and whimsy to the poems.
